Wildcardracing Posted February 9, 2008 Report Posted February 9, 2008 (edited) I currently run 18cc domes (180 psi approx) and +4 timing on a woods ported 350cc motor. I always run straight vp110 fuel mixed 40:1.With my current pipe combo Paul Turner Mids I am thinking that more timing might be better. PTR mids are not a top end pipe as it is so if I lose a bit on the over rev for more power everywhere else it wouldnt matter. Anyone else here running more than +4 degrees on a trail ridden bike? I don't know how far you want to push it. That's a lot of compression to be throwing more timing at on a trail bike. When she gets good and hot on slower sections you might start running into detonation issues. If you do, you better check your plugs frequently for the first while to monitor it. just my .02 Edited February 9, 2008 by slobanshee06 Quote
